Box Score PAXTON, Mass. – Sophomore forward Nicole Johnson (Westhampton, Mass.) scored two goals and added an assist to spark Nichols College to a 5-1 victory over Anna Maria College on a cold and windy Wednesday afternoon at Klingele Field. Senior Kaila Gray (Pembroke, N.H.) added a pair of scores for the Bison, who improved their The Commonwealth Coast Conference record to 6-6-1 and secured the eighth seed in the TCCC playoffs. Nichols, which wrapped up the regular season with a 10-7-1 overall mark, will travel to top seed Endicott (12-0-1) Saturday for a 1 p.m. TCCC quarterfinal game.
The Bison came out of the gate strong as Gray scored the game's first goal in just the seventh minute of play. Nichols continued to apply the pressure, scoring three goals in three minutes as first-year forward Chelsea Shaughnessy (Halifax, Mass.), Johnson, and Gray all found the back of the net.
The AMCATS showed signs of life while getting an unassisted goal from freshman Amanda Hevy before the first half came to a close with the Bison leading 4-1.
Johnson added another goal in the second half as the Bison went on to take the game by the final score of 5-1.
Senior netminder Sarah Levesque (Ludlow, Mass.) made six saves in the game, including four second-half stops, in the win. Karine Almeida shouldered the loss with eight saves for Anna Maria, which finishes the season at 3-12-4, going 0-12-1 in conference play.
